OSHKOSH, Wis. (Blugolds.com) - The University of Wisconsin-Eau Claire women's swim team dominated the pool at Albee Hall in Oshkosh, winning 13 events to best UW-Oshkosh.
Hannah Sisto, Elissa Hermsen, and Allison Hable took 1-2-3 in the 200-yard freestyle, the first event won by the Blugolds, with times of 2:03.91, 2:08.16, and 2:08.96.
Samantha Senczyszyn continues to dominate the 50-yard freestyle, winning with a time of 24.80, followed closely by her teammates Brittany Farr and Molly Quinlan, with times of 26.60 and 27.15, respectively.
The success continued in the 200-yard IM, with the Blugolds taking the top four spots, topped by Madeline Gray, with a time of 2:20.81.
The 200 yard butterfly was fielded by only two swimmers, both from UWEC. Molly Quinlan finished first with a time of 2:29.89, and Nicole Bellford followed with a time of 2:03.69.
Allison Hable topped the 100-yard freestyle, followed by Rachel Chatwin and Ellie Hostetler, who tied for second with a time of 58.40.
The 200-yard backstroke was taken by Rachel Treadway, finishing with a time of 2:18.83.
Nina Tabatabai won the 500-yard freestyle with a time of 5:45.76, followed by Nicole Bellford at 5:49.60, beating the next swimmer by 10 seconds.
Kate French edged out her opponents in the 3 meter dive, ending up with a score of 260.63.
The last event of the day for the women's swim and dive team was the 800-yard freestyle relay, and the Blugolds took this one as well. The team of Brittany Farr, Reilly Peterson, Hannah Sisto, and Samantha Senczyszyn destroyed the competition, finishing with a time of 8:23.44.
"We were able to mix things up a bit and see some people swim some different events." said head coach Anne Ryder. "The team raced hard and I was pleased with their performances."
